預計塑膠化妝品包裝市場規模將從2024年的324億美元成長到2034年的498億美元,年複合成長率約為4.4%。塑膠化妝品包裝市場涵蓋專為美容和個人保健產品設計的塑膠包裝解決方案,包括瓶子、罐子、軟管、粉盒以及其他旨在提升產品吸引力和功能性的產品。創新重點在於永續性、可回收性和美觀性客製化。消費者對美容產品和環保包裝的需求不斷成長,推動了市場成長,其中輕巧、耐用和美觀的解決方案尤其重要。

受消費者對永續且美觀的包裝解決方案需求不斷成長的推動,塑膠化妝品包裝市場正呈現強勁成長動能。其中,瓶裝產品因其用途廣泛,在護膚和護髮產品中廣泛應用,成為成長最快的細分市場;其次是軟管包裝,因其方便易用且能精準控制用量,在乳霜和乳液等產品中廣受歡迎。

罐裝產品細分市場發展勢頭強勁,尤其是在高階化妝品領域,高階包裝有助於提升品牌形象。泵頭和分配器也日益普及,因其功能性和衛生性更佳而受到消費者和製造商的青睞。無氣包裝解決方案正成為維持產品品質和延長保存期限的關鍵趨勢。

客製化和創新設計是關鍵的差異化因素,品牌都在尋求獨特的包裝以在競爭激烈的市場中脫穎而出。隨著消費者對永續性的偏好日益增強,環保材料和可回收選項的普及也進一步塑造了產業趨勢。

塑膠化妝品包裝市場以產品種類繁多和價格競爭激烈為特徵。市場領導專注於創新,推出吸引消費者興趣的新產品,並拓展產品線。優質化趨勢十分顯著,各大品牌優先考慮兼具永續性和美觀性的設計。這種對環保材料和創新設計的關注正在重塑消費者偏好,並推動市場需求。

塑膠化妝品包裝市場競爭激烈,主要企業紛紛尋求透過技術創新和策略聯盟實現差異化。監管政策,尤其是在歐洲和北美等地區,正在推動永續性和環境責任的落實。各公司都在以嚴格的標準為標桿,以提升自身的競爭優勢。市場正日益轉向可生物分解和可回收材料,這與全球永續性目標相契合。這種監管環境正在推動創新,鼓勵綠色實踐的採用,為市場參與企業創造了豐厚的機會。

主要趨勢和促進因素:

受消費者偏好和永續性計劃的推動,塑膠化妝品包裝市場正經歷蓬勃發展。一個關鍵趨勢是轉向環保材料,各大品牌紛紛採用可生物分解和可回收的包裝解決方案。這一趨勢的驅動力源於日益增強的環保意識和減少塑膠廢棄物的監管壓力。此外,消費者對展現環保責任感的品牌的偏好也進一步推動了對永續包裝的需求。

另一個關鍵趨勢是個人化和高階包裝設計的興起。隨著消費者追求獨特和優質的體驗,化妝品品牌正加大對創新包裝的投入,以提升產品的吸引力和差異化。融合QR碼和NFC標籤的智慧包裝技術日益普及,提供互動體驗並方便消費者獲取產品資訊。此外,小型化、便於攜帶的包裝也成為一種顯著趨勢,迎合了現代消費者快節奏的生活方式。

市場成長主要受美容及個人護理行業的推動,而這又源於消費者對護膚和化妝品日益成長的需求。新興市場由於可支配收入的增加和都市化進程的加快,正經歷著強勁的成長。另一個關鍵促進因素是電子商務的快速發展,線上零售平台的擴張需要兼具保護性和美觀性的包裝解決方案。能夠成功掌握這些趨勢和促進因素的公司,將更能掌握這個快速成長市場中盈利商機。

Plastic Cosmetic Packaging Market is anticipated to expand from $32.4 billion in 2024 to $49.8 billion by 2034, growing at a CAGR of approximately 4.4%. The Plastic Cosmetic Packaging Market encompasses packaging solutions crafted from plastic materials, tailored for beauty and personal care products. This market includes bottles, jars, tubes, and compacts designed to enhance product appeal and functionality. Innovations focus on sustainability, recyclability, and aesthetic customization. The rising demand for beauty products and eco-friendly packaging drives market growth, emphasizing lightweight, durable, and visually appealing solutions.

The Plastic Cosmetic Packaging Market is experiencing robust growth, propelled by the increasing demand for sustainable and aesthetically appealing packaging solutions. The bottles segment is the top-performing sub-segment, driven by its versatility and widespread use in skincare and haircare products. Tubes follow closely, favored for their convenience and ability to dispense precise amounts, making them popular for creams and lotions.

Tariff Impact:

The global tariff landscape, coupled with geopolitical tensions, is significantly influencing the Plastic Cosmetic Packaging Market. In Japan and South Korea, firms are navigating increased costs by investing in sustainable packaging innovations and localizing supply chains. China, facing trade barriers, is prioritizing self-sufficiency in raw materials and expanding its domestic market reach. Taiwan's strategic role in plastic resin production is crucial, yet vulnerable to geopolitical instability. The parent market is experiencing moderate growth, driven by consumer demand for eco-friendly packaging solutions. By 2035, market evolution will hinge on technological advancements and strategic regional partnerships. Middle East conflicts could exacerbate global supply chain disruptions and elevate energy prices, impacting production costs and logistics across the sector.

Geographical Overview:

The plastic cosmetic packaging market is witnessing varied dynamics across different regions, each presenting unique opportunities. In North America, the market is expanding due to high consumer demand for innovative and sustainable packaging solutions. The region's focus on eco-friendly materials is driving growth, with companies investing in biodegradable and recyclable packaging.

Europe follows as a significant market, emphasizing sustainability and regulatory compliance. The European Union's stringent regulations on packaging waste are propelling manufacturers to innovate and adopt greener practices. This has led to an increased demand for eco-friendly cosmetic packaging solutions in the region.

In Asia Pacific, rapid urbanization and a burgeoning middle class are fueling market growth. Countries like China and India are emerging as key players, with rising consumer awareness and demand for premium cosmetic products boosting packaging needs. Latin America and the Middle East & Africa are also showing promise, with growing investments in cosmetic industries and increasing consumer preference for sustainable packaging options.

Key Trends and Drivers:

The Plastic Cosmetic Packaging Market is experiencing dynamic growth driven by evolving consumer preferences and sustainability initiatives. Key trends include the shift towards eco-friendly materials, with brands adopting biodegradable and recyclable packaging solutions. This trend is fueled by increasing environmental awareness and regulatory pressures to reduce plastic waste. The demand for sustainable packaging is further bolstered by consumers' preference for brands that demonstrate environmental responsibility.

Another significant trend is the rise of personalized and luxurious packaging designs. As consumers seek unique and premium experiences, cosmetic brands are investing in innovative packaging that enhances product appeal and differentiation. Smart packaging technologies, incorporating QR codes and NFC tags, are gaining traction, offering interactive experiences and product information access. The trend towards smaller, travel-friendly packaging is also notable, catering to the on-the-go lifestyle of modern consumers.

Market drivers include the growing beauty and personal care industry, with increased demand for skincare and cosmetic products. Emerging markets are witnessing robust growth, driven by rising disposable incomes and urbanization. The e-commerce boom is another critical driver, as online retail platforms expand, necessitating protective and visually appealing packaging solutions. Companies that can align with these trends and drivers are well-positioned to capitalize on lucrative opportunities in this burgeoning market.
